Trump fights to suppress Georgia election interference charges.

TL;DR Summary
Donald Trump's attorneys filed a motion to quash the report of a special grand jury that conducted a criminal investigation into whether there were any "coordinated attempts to unlawfully alter the outcome of the 2020 elections" in Georgia by him and his allies. They asked that all evidence stemming from the special grand jury be deemed unconstitutional and that Fulton County District Attorney Fani Willis be "disqualified from further investigation and/or prosecution of this matter" or any related matter derived from use of special purpose grand jury. The grand jury completed its work in January, submitting a report on its findings to Willis.
